What is remote vocal performance?

Remote vocal performance refers to singing or voice work that is recorded, broadcast, or performed from a location outside of a traditional studio, often from the performer's home. Advances in technology allow vocalists to collaborate with producers, musicians, and clients around the world using digital audio workstations (DAWs), high-quality microphones, and online communication tools. This setup is commonly used for music production, voiceovers, jingles, and even live virtual concerts, making it possible for vocalists to work with a global clientele.

What is the difference between Remote Vocal Performance vs Remote Voice Actor?

AspectRemote Vocal PerformanceRemote Voice Actor
CredentialsVocal training, singing experienceVoice acting training, acting skills
Work EnvironmentMusic studios, live performances, recordingsRecording studios, home studios, remote sessions
Industry UsageMusic, concerts, musical theaterAnimation, commercials, video games, dubbing
Search & Comparison IntentPerformance, singing, live showsVoiceover, character voices, narration

Remote Vocal Performance involves singing and musical performances, often requiring vocal training and live or recorded music work. Remote Voice Actor focuses on providing voiceovers for media, requiring acting skills and voice acting experience. While both roles use remote recording setups, their industries and skill sets differ significantly.

How does collaboration typically work for remote vocal performance roles?

In remote vocal performance roles, collaboration is often managed through digital communication platforms and project management tools. Vocalists may work closely with producers, composers, and other musicians by exchanging audio files, participating in virtual meetings, and providing feedback asynchronously. Clear communication, timely file sharing, and adaptability to various recording setups are essential to ensure the creative vision is achieved. While you may not be physically present with the team, being proactive and responsive can help foster strong professional relationships and successful project outcomes.
